After a natural disaster, it’s important to take the necessary steps to restore your home. This process can be daunting, but by following these tips, you can get your home back to normal in no time.
The first step is to assess the damage. This means taking a look at both the exterior and interior of your home and making a list of all the repairs that need to be made. Once you have a list of the repairs, you can start to work on them one by one.
If your home has sustained major damage, you may need to hire a professional contractor to help with the repairs. However, for minor damage, you can likely do the repairs yourself.
Next, you’ll need to clean up any debris that may be left behind from the disaster. This includes things like fallen tree branches, broken glass, and anything else that may be hazardous. Once the debris is cleared, you can start to repair any damage that was done to your home.
Finally, you’ll need to restock your home with all the essentials. This includes food, water, and other supplies that you may need in the event of another disaster. By following these steps, you can restore your home after a natural disaster.
